National Scholarship Portal (NSP) is a gateway to avail scholarships for students who are in need of some funds from class 1st to post–doctoral level.

This mission is launched by the Ministry of Electronics & Information Technology, the Indian government, and offers multiple scholarship schemes for students who belong to minority communities, including OBC (Other Backward Class), ST (Schedule Tribes), and SC (Schedule Cast).

Overview of NSP

NSP is a digital platform that includes multiple scholarships from the All India Council of Technical Education (AICTE) and the University Grant Commission (UGC), along with scholarships which are offered by the central and state governments. If you enter via the NSP portal, then students can easily apply for these scholarship programs.

What are the schemes offered by NSP?

NSP provides a range of scholarships for minority students who belong to less-income families and want to pursue their education but have to withdraw because of a lack of funds. Hand in hand with the Central government, state government, AICTE and UGC. The NSP helps students from various sections of society and also distributes funds as per multiple schemes.

Step-by-step process of NSP login

Before beginning with the NSP login process, students need to register themselves for applying to the scholarship program. The process of NSP registration is an important step without which students will not be able to move ahead to the NSP login process. Once you are successfully registered, you can initiate the login process.

Here are the login steps which you need to follow

  1. First, visit the official website of NSP.
  2. Now click on login in the application form option.
  3. After this, select a fresher option, i.e., fresh 2022-23
  4. Now you will be redirected to a new page.
  5. Here enter your application ID along with password and CAPTCHA code.
  6. Once done, hit the login button.
  7. Now when the application forms open, you have to enter the following details.
  • Email ID
  • Identification details
  • Gender
  • Scheme type
  • Scholarship Category
  • Bank account number
  • Bank IFSC code
  • Bank name
  • Mobile number
  • Date of birth
  • State of domicile
  • Name of student
  1. After filling in these details, click on the save and continue option
  2. Now again, you will be redirected to a new page
  3. Here you have to upload the scanned copy of documents which are asked on the portal.
  4. After this, click on the final submission button.

Documents needed for NSP login

  1. Verification form provided by educational institute
  2. Photos
  3. Self-certified community certificate
  4. Community certificate
  5. Income certificate issuedissued by the state government
  6. Fee receipt of the current course year
  7. Self-attestedmark sheets
  8. Domicile certificate
  9. Bank account number and IFSC code passbook copy
  10. Bonfied student certificate from institute/school
  11. Aadhar card, both scanned copy and hard copy.
